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
58 41 97221488623
530051536 09605817337
530051536 09605817337
0034486771 218 96368 7846098381 36176506024
All about undefined
Interested in learning more?
530051536 09605817337
0034486771 218 96368 7846098381 36176506024
See more
502882 8471247191
681398 30691260 51
See more
7284339 9022 674
88666 7498642 66 39
See more